Semi Crash on I-94 Sends Truck Over Bridge and Onto Underpass in Minnesota

A dramatic crash between two semi-trucks in west-central Minnesota sent one of the vehicles careening off Interstate 94 and down onto an underpass Wednesday morning.
The incident occurred around 10:20 a.m. on June 4, 2025, in Otter Tail County, according to the Minnesota State Patrol. Authorities reported that two semis collided on I-94, causing one to leave the roadway near a bridge and crash onto the County Road 10 underpass below.
Photos shared by the State Patrol show the striking aftermath, including major damage to the semi that went over the bridge. That vehicle was reportedly pulling two trailers when it left the highway.
While the condition of the second semi is unclear, one of the released images shows it stopped on the I-94 bridge above.
One of the drivers was taken to the hospital with injuries that are not considered life-threatening.
As of 12:30 p.m., I-94 had reopened, but County Road 10 remained closed as crews worked at the scene.
